CLASS DESCRIPTION A Social Program Administrator I plans and coordinates the activities of a small social program. Work of this class may involve supervising social program personnel. SELECTION PROCESS All candidates indicating the minimum qualifications on their applications will be placed on the eligible list without further examination. The training and experience of each candidate will be evaluated for appropriateness and quantity. It is essential, therefore, that you give complete and accurate information on your application. Vagueness or omission may prevent you from being considered for this position. Qualified candidates will not be listed in rank order. M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S On or before the date of filing the application, each candidate must: EDUCATION: Have a bachelor's degree from an accredited college or university. AND EXPERIENCE: Have two years of experience in social planning, social work, social program supervision or coordination or a related field. OR NOTES (EQUIVALENCIES): Have an equivalent combination of education and experience. KNOWLEDGES, SKILLS AND ABILITIES Knowledge of the principles and techniques of administration. Knowledge of basic community social problems. Knowledge of basic counseling techniques. Ability to plan, organize, implement and administer a social program. Ability to make budget recommendations and control expenditures. Ability to develop and install program procedures. Ability to evaluate program effectiveness. Ability to speak and write effectively. Ability to deal with program recipients, community groups and representatives of public and private agencies. Administrative ability.
